Our National Security Solutions team needs a Sr. System Administrator to support our expanding portfolio of work in the Intelligence Community (IC). As a collaborative member of a small and mostly autonomous team, this position directly supports secure enclave development networks.

Core Tasks:
  • Conduct functional and connectivity testing to ensure continuing operability.
  • Develop and document systems administration standard operating procedures.
  • Maintain baseline system security according to organizational policies.
  • Manage accounts, network rights, and access to systems and equipment.
  • Plan, execute, and verify data redundancy and system recovery procedures.
  • Install, update, and troubleshoot systems and servers.
  • Comply with organization systems administration standard operating procedures.
  • Implement and enforce local network usage policies and procedures.
  • Manage system and server resources including performance, capacity, availability, serviceability, and recoverability.
  • Monitor and maintain system and server configurations.
  • Perform repairs on faulty system and server hardware.
  • Troubleshoot hardware/software interface and interoperability problems.

Required:
  • Bachelor's degree in a technical discipline and 15 years' experience as a System Administrator, OR High school diploma and 20 years' experience as a System Administrator
  • Experience with Windows Sever Administration, Active Directory, and Group Policy
  • Familiarity with Linux Server Administration
  • Familiarity with VMware/ESXi, VMWare Virtual Networking, and VMware vCenter
  • Networking Switching and Router Management
  • Storage Management (NetApp)
  • Hardware and Operating System troubleshooting
  • System hardening
  • Security Compliance Scanning (Nessus, ACAS)
  • Understanding of project design within the scope of security (RMF) requirements
  • Active TS/SCI security clearance with polygraph
  • Active DoD IAT Level II certification (e.g. CCNA-Security, CySA+, GICSP, GSEC, Security+ CE, CND, SSCP)
  • Ability to demonstrate cyber/IT related experience with attention to detail, customer service, oral and written communication, and problem solving.

Security Clearance Requirement:
An active Top Secret SCI w/Polygraph security clearance is required for this position.
